Transaction 8543f8c84aee93d0abebd910f94529196e4b932778ac490bb194d80ceb474c40

1 Input
2 Outputs
  • 8543f8c84aee93d0abebd910f94529196e4b932778ac490bb194d80ceb474c40:0
  • value  25732947428
    address  2NG5ejCyCdvNGmCQgPyLj9HsXS1Wq3noWSg
  • 8543f8c84aee93d0abebd910f94529196e4b932778ac490bb194d80ceb474c40:1
  • value  10077727
    address  2NBMEXFsa5gdghxdVhrhr1CHYVKCNpSKZur